https://bugs.freebsd.org/bugzilla/show_bug.cgi?id=3D284049 Bug ID: 284049 Summary: mrsas(4) does not expose a /dev/sesX device while mfi(4) does Product: Base System Version: 14.2-STABLE Hardware: Any OS: Any Status: New Severity: Affects Only Me Priority: --- Component: kern Assignee: bugs@FreeBSD.org Reporter: terry-freebsd@glaver.org Created attachment 256679 --> https://bugs.freebsd.org/bugzilla/attachment.cgi?id=3D256679&action= =3Dedit dmesg extract when booting with mfi(4) In switching from the mfi(4) to mrsas(4), the backplane on a Dell PowerEdge R730 with a PERC H730P controller disappears. Attached are two kernel boot log extracts (grepping for ^ses) from the same hardware and the same kernel (14.2-STABLE), once with the mfi(4) driver and once with the mrsas(4) driver, switched with the usual hw.mfi.mrsas_enable= =3D1 tunable in /boot/loader.conf. Losing the ses device for the main drive backplane means that I cannot moni= tor drive stats, so this is more than an inconvenience. --=20 You are receiving this mail because: You are the assignee for the bug.=
